Bachelor's Degree or Higher in Anne Arundel County, Maryland
Anne Arundel County, Maryland has a bachelor's degree or higher of 45.8%, which ranks #158 of 3,222 out of 3,222 counties nationwide. This is 35.8% above the national value of 33.7%.
Within Maryland, Anne Arundel County ranks #4 of 24 out of 24 counties. This places it in the 95th percentile nationally.
Percentage of the population aged 25+ with a bachelor's degree or higher. All data comes from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ates for 2024.
